12 best places to live in the United States

The FrontierThe FrontierMarch 24, 2026 783 Minutes read0

•Washington, DC

The landscape of American living has shifted significantly in 2026.

While the glitz of coastal giants still holds sway, the “Best Places to Live” story of today is one of balance —where career opportunities meet manageable costs and a high quality of life.

Based on current 2026 rankings from U.S. News, Niche, and RentCafe, here are the 12 best places to call home in the United States.

1. Washington, D.C.

The nation’s capital has surged to the top of livability rankings this year. Beyond its role as a political hub, D.C. has invested heavily in healthcare access and professional networking infrastructure. It currently ranks #1 for quality of life, offering young professionals a density of associations and social clubs unmatched by any other U.S. metro.

2. Johns Creek, Georgia

Consistently topping “Best Places to Raise a Family” lists, this Atlanta suburb is a masterclass in suburban excellence. It boasts the #1 safety designation in the country for its size, paired with a public school system that regularly produces some of the highest college-readiness scores in the Southeast.

3. Naperville, Illinois

For the third consecutive year, Naperville remains the gold standard for Midwestern living. Located just outside Chicago, it offers a “big city” job market with a “small town” community feel. Its Riverwalk and highly-rated library system make it a perennial favourite for those seeking stability and top-tier education.

4. Carmel, Indiana

Carmel has become famous not just for its many roundabouts, but for its meticulous urban planning. The city’s Arts & Design District and the Monon Trail provide a walkable, high-end lifestyle with a cost of living that remains remarkably lower than its coastal counterparts.

5. Austin, Texas

Nicknamed “Silicon Hills,” Austin continues to be the primary destination for the tech-migrant. While housing prices have stabilised after the boom of the early 2020s, the city’s unique blend of “Keep Austin Weird” culture, legendary BBQ, and a robust startup ecosystem keeps it at the forefront of desirability.

6. Portland, Maine

Portland proves that you don’t need a million residents to have a world-class food and art scene. Ranking second in “location and community,” this coastal gem offers a dense healthcare network and a superior work-life balance for those who prioritise the outdoors and craft culture over the corporate grind.

7. Cary, North Carolina

Nestled in the Research Triangle, Cary is the preferred home for the region’s PhDs and tech workers. It is one of the safest municipalities in the country and features over 80 miles of greenway trails, making it an ideal “well-planned” city for active families.

8. Overland Park, Kansas

Often overlooked, Overland Park is a powerhouse of affordability and education. It consistently ranks in the top 10 for “Best Places to Buy a House,” offering expansive suburban lots and high-performing schools for a fraction of the price found in the Northeast or West Coast.

9. Ann Arbor, Michigan

Home to the University of Michigan, this city is a hub for research, healthcare, and wellness. It ranks among the nation’s highest for healthcare provider concentration and offers a vibrant, intellectual atmosphere fueled by one of the most educated workforces in the country.

10. Plano, Texas

Plano is the economic engine of North Texas. With an unemployment rate sitting near 2.8%, it is a magnet for corporate headquarters. Families are drawn here for the “Academy High School” programs and the city’s commitment to maintaining extensive park systems like the Oak Point Park and Nature Preserve.

11. Boise, Idaho

Boise remains the king of the “Fresh Start” cities. It offers a diversified job market that has moved well beyond its agricultural roots into tech and green energy. Residents here enjoy a “15-minute city” lifestyle where the foothills for hiking and the Boise River for paddling are always within reach.

12. Wilmington, North Carolina

Wilmington has emerged in 2026 as the top city for economic opportunity and relocation ease. With a 47% increase in new jobs over the last five years and a high concentration of sports and social clubs, it is the premier choice for those looking to hit the “reset button” in a scenic, coastal environment.
